Emergency Tree Removal in Bucks County, PA
Emergency tree removal services are essential for addressing urgent situations involving damaged, fallen, or hazardous trees that pose a risk to property or safety. This service covers projects such as removing trees that have been compromised by storms, severe weather, or disease, especially when immediate action is necessary to prevent further damage or injury. Property owners should understand the importance of assessing the risk factors, such as leaning trees, cracked branches, or visible instability, before requesting emergency removal to ensure the situation is handled promptly and safely.
Homeowners and property managers typically seek emergency tree removal when a tree threatens structures, power lines, or public pathways, or if it has already fallen onto a property. It is important to consider the location of the tree, the extent of damage, and potential safety hazards when requesting this service. Proper planning and assessment can help determine the best approach for removing the tree quickly and efficiently, minimizing the risk of additional damage or injury to people and property.
